> Are there any examples of how to use this?
> 
> Since the current C++ (until C++0x is out) doesn't support vector
> initialization, how does one format the inheritance constructor?
> for example:
> myblock::myblock(...) : gr_block("myblock", gr_make_io_signaturev(4,4,
> std::vector<int> somevec)) { ...} 
> 
> in what code do I populate somevec? or is there another way to attack this?

Take a look at gr_io_signature.cc.  It uses gr_make_io_signaturev to
implement the other versions.

Do you really have more than 3 different kinds of items in your signature?
